How to Actually Find a Decent No Deposit Offer (Without Getting Ripped Off)
You want the best free spins offer 2026 UK no deposit claim? You need to be a detective. Here is my process.
Step 1: Check the License. Is the casino regulated by the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C)? If yes, you have a safety net. If not, walk away. UKGC rules mandate fair play and faster withdrawals, though the rules are still annoying.
Step 2: Read the “Max Cashout” Clause. This is the single most important number. Look for offers with a max cashout of at least £100. Anything below £50 is a waste of time. You are gambling to win pocket change.
Step 3: Calculate the Wagering. Look for wagering on winnings (not on the bonus amount) and aim for 35x or lower. 40x is borderline. 50x+ is a scam. Also, check what games count 100%. Slots usually do. Table games often count 10% or 0%.
Step 4: Check the Expiry. You usually have 7 days to use the spins and then 72 hours to meet the wagering. That is tight. I prefer offers that give you at least 10 days for the whole process.
Step 5: Look for “No Wagering” or “Wager Free” Spins. These are rare, but they exist. PlayOJO was famous for this (they still offer it on some promos). You win £10, you withdraw £10. No playthrough. That is the holy grail.

FAQ: The Questions I Get Asked Every Day
People always ask the same things. Here are the answers, without the marketing fluff.
Do I have to deposit to withdraw my free spin winnings?
Usually, no. If you win from a true no deposit bonus, you can withdraw the winnings (after meeting wagering) without ever depositing. Some casinos might ask you to deposit to “activate” a withdrawal method, but that is rare. Check the terms.
Can I use a VPN to claim a UK free spins offer from abroad?
No. Do not do this. The casino will detect it, void your winnings, and ban your account. They check IP addresses. If you are a UK resident, you must claim from a UK IP.
What is the typical wagering requirement for a no deposit bonus?
From what I’ve seen in 2026, the average is 40x to 50x on winnings. I refuse to promote anything over 45x. Look for 30x or less. It makes a massive difference to your chance of cashing out.
Are free spins offers worth it for high rollers?
No. If you are a high roller, a £5 max win from free spins is meaningless. High rollers should look for deposit match bonuses with high max bet limits. Free spins are for casual players or for testing a new casino.
Why do casinos limit the game I can use free spins on?
To control their risk. They offer spins on games with lower volatility or higher house edge (like some older NetEnt slots). This ensures the casino keeps more money overall. It is not about giving you a good deal. It is about marketing.
